    a company has two divisions, A and B. Division A manufactures a component which is transferred to division B.Division B uses two units of the component from Division A in every item of finished product that it makes and sells. The transfer price is $43 per unit of the component

    Selling price of finished product made in Division B————————————————–154$
    Variable production costs in Division B excluding the cost of transfers from Div..A————32
    Variable selling costs chargeable to the division————————————————-1

    Fixed costs——-160000
    External sales in units—–7000
    Investment in division -500000
    cost of capital—16%

    Solution

    Sales(7000*154)————1078

    Variable cost in Division B(7000*33)

    Costs of Transfer(14000*43)

    Here my question is that if Division B uses two units of the component from Division A in every item of finished product that it makes and sells then:

    The below 32$ is my 7000 units production cost

    1) Variable production costs in Division B excluding the cost of transfers from Div..A————32

    2)Variable selling costs chargeable to the division————————————————-1

    Why i charge here 1$ on 7000 units not 14000 units?in facts If i buy 14000 units from internal division and the selling and distribution cost from Division A is 1$ then it should be 14000*1$

    B is incurring the selling and distribution costs and they are selling 7,000 units. The fact that each unit uses 2 components has no relevance to the selling and distribution costs for B.

    The question does not say anywhere that division A charges $1 for internal transfer!!! It says that the selling and distribution costs are $1 and is division B that will insure those charges because it is Division B that is selling to outside customers.
